Delrin® Acetal Homopolymer for Precision Industrial Applications
Delrin® is a high-performance acetal homopolymer widely used in industrial manufacturing for parts that require strength, stiffness, low friction, and excellent dimensional stability. As a trusted thermoplastic material, Delrin® is commonly selected by engineers, fabricators, and product designers for applications where reliable performance and precision are critical.
Why Choose Delrin®?
Delrin® offers a strong balance of mechanical properties and machinability, making it a popular choice for components that must withstand repeated use and maintain tight tolerances. Its combination of high tensile strength, low moisture absorption, and good wear resistance supports use in demanding environments across many industries.
- High stiffness and strength
- Excellent dimensional stability
- Low friction and good wear resistance
- Low moisture absorption
- Good machinability for precision parts
- Suitable for a wide range of industrial applications
Common Delrin® Applications
Delrin® is used in a broad range of applications where durable, low-friction plastic components are required. It is often specified for mechanical parts, housings, and moving components that benefit from consistent performance and long service life.
- Gears, bearings, and bushings
- Rollers and wear strips
- Valve components and fluid handling parts
- Conveyor and material handling components
- Electrical and electronic device parts
- Precision machined industrial components
- Automotive and transportation parts
Material Performance Benefits
Delrin® is known for maintaining its properties in applications that demand repeatability and accurate movement. Its low coefficient of friction can help reduce wear in moving assemblies, while its strength and rigidity support load-bearing parts. Because it absorbs minimal moisture, Delrin® can help maintain part geometry in environments where humidity may affect other materials.
For manufacturers, Delrin® can be a practical material choice when converting metal components to plastic for weight reduction, noise reduction, or improved manufacturability. It is also frequently used in parts that require fine detail, close tolerances, and dependable performance over time.
Fabrication and Machining
Delrin® is well suited for machining and fabrication. It can be cut, drilled, turned, and milled into precision components, making it a strong option for prototypes, custom parts, and production runs. Fabricators often choose Delrin® for applications that require clean edges, stable dimensions, and efficient processing.
When selecting a thermoplastic for CNC machining or formed components, Delrin® is often considered for its combination of processability and end-use performance. It is available in forms that support efficient converting and custom manufacturing workflows.
